He was so tired he could barely hold on to the walking stick. Would his search ever be over he wondered. It had been many days since his faithful sheepdog, Marley had disappeared. The old sheep herder was determined to find him, no matter how long it took.

Growing frail from not eating his usual homemade meals and walking nonstop caused him pain, but he kept going. His lips were dry from whistling the familiar call Marley would recognize. He had heard stories of dogs returning from great distances. If you never had a constant companion like Marley, you wouldn’t understand. Every day the man felt it would be this sunset he would sit down to rest on a grassy patch and finally see Marley running up to him. He believed even the sheep felt his absence.

This cloudy day the rainy mist covered the valley below. Perhaps Marley had taken shelter in that grove of trees. Just a few steps more and maybe, possibly, hopefully, he would whistle and see Marley’s silhouette.
